Water pollution is the contamination of water as a result of human activities. It is primarily caused by the discharge of inadequately treated wastewater into natural water streams leading to environmental degradation and impacts on public health. Other effects include eutrophication, acidity, anoxia, etc. Common contaminants contributing to water pollution include chemicals and pathogens. Water pollution can be classified as surface water, groundwater and marine pollution. The measurement of water pollution is done by analyzing water samples with a variety of physical, chemical and biological tests. Prevention of pollution can be achieved by the adoption of appropriate sewage and industrial treatments, control of urban runoff, agricultural wastewater management, erosion and sediment control, etc. This book provides comprehensive insights into the field of water pollution. It discusses some existing theories and innovative concepts revolving around water pollution, its treatment and mitigation strategies.
